This lesson explores the complexities of family dynamics and relationship safety. Students will examine how changes in family structure and cultural contexts affect individuals, learn to differentiate key relationship concepts, and recognize the importance of safety—both physical and digital. Students will also discover the diversity of modern families, understand trusted adult roles, and explore healthy relationship traits.
